A business-focused show that leans into practical marketing tactics, mindset shifts, and actionable strategies for owners and operators. Episodes frequently blend marketing psychology, branding, and personal development with guest perspectives on networking, leadership, work-life balance, and startup pivots. The tone is warm and actionable, often centered around cross-channel strategies, practical tips, and real-world examples from a diverse slate of guests. A standout is the host's knack for making complex concepts approachable while weaving in relatable stories, community-building vibes, and a champagne-fueled sense of momentum that keeps listeners coming back for motivation and repeatable playbooks.
